E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ases a set of stove tiles depicting two legendary figures, Alexander the Great and Nimrod. Created by Georg Leupold, a talented German artist active in the 17th century, these lead-glazed earthenware tiles were crafted in Nuremberg, Germany during the mid-17th century. The intricate details and vibrant colors of these stove tiles are truly remarkable. Each tile tells a story of its own, capturing the essence and grandeur of both Alexander the Great and Nimrod. These historical figures are depicted with great skill and precision, showcasing their power and influence. Alexander the Great was known for his military prowess as well as his ambition to conquer vast territories. Nimrod, on the other hand, is a biblical figure associated with great strength and leadership.
